SHAHEEN: AMERICANS ARE WAKING UP TO HIGHER HEALTH CARE COSTS TODAY IT'S PAST TIME FOR CONGRESS TO EXTEND A LIFELINE FOR MILLIONS OF AMERICANS
States News Service
The following information was released by New Hampshire Senator Jeanne Shaheen:
U.S. Senator Jeanne Shaheen (D-NH), author of bicameral legislation that would permanently extend the Affordable Care Act (ACA) enhanced premium tax credits, released the following statement marking the beginning of open enrollment:
"With the opening of the health insurance Marketplace today, millions of Americans in every state across this country are waking up to drastically higher premiums for the same health care coverage they're already on all because Congress could not come together to extend the vital enhanced premium tax credits that make health care more affordable. It is crystal clear that we must not allow the tax credits to expire this year, or the American people will be left footing the bill for soaring health care costs at a time when too many are struggling to stay afloat.
"Extending these tax credits is one of the most immediate and effective ways to address the cost-of-living crisis that is making it harder and harder for working families to make ends meet. I sincerely hope that we can end the logjam in Congress and avoid a suffocating health care cost hike for millions of families. It's what our constituents expectand deservefrom their elected representatives."
